In today’s era necessity of non-Conventional energy has increased as the requirement of power is also increasing gradually. Renewable sources such as solar, wind etc. are used to deal with this human necessity of power. However, these sources are not enough and alongside the wastage of energy is increasing by several means. To overcome this problem, we intent to employ the power released by human locomotion by engineering the floors with piezo electric sensors specially in more populated areas. These sensors sense the pressure of footsteps and convert the same into electrical energy. This will neither adulterate the environment, nor the change in climatic conditions can affect this. This kind of technology is an economical way of power generation and has ample of applications.
